A Lithuanian man, who was on the run from prison when he shot dead a man in Co Down, has today been jailed for seven years.
Deividas Paliutis (aged 29) of no fixed abode, pleaded guilty to the manslaughter of Ukrainian Dymtro Grytsunov, on April 23, 2011.
He fired the gun during a dispute between a group of men at his partner's house and struck his victim in the chest.
The Central Criminal Court heard he was on the run from Loughan House open prison in Co Cavan, where he had been serving a one-year sentence for assault causing harm.
Although the killing took place in the North, he opted to be tried in the Republic of Ireland.
He was originally charged with murder, but he pleaded guilty to manslaughter and this was accepted by the DPP.
